WebThe fiscal year is the accounting period of the federal government, which runs from October 1 to September 30 of the following year. When Congress and the president fail to agree on and pass one or more of the regular appropriations bills, a continuing resolution can be passed instead. WebJun 24, 2024 · Also known as the civil year, the calendar year refers to a one-year period, beginning on Jan. 1 and ending on Dec. 31. Based on the Gregorian calendar, a calendar year lasts 365 days and 366 days during a leap year. The U.S. federal budget is the amount of spending and revenue for the next fiscal year of the U.S. government. It runs from October 1 through September 30. Some provisions of law authorize the Congress to provide funds through a future appropriation act to carry out a program or function. Such authorizations of appropriations, which are the subject of this report, differ from other authorizations (sometimes called enabling or organic statutes) that create a federal agency, establish a …
